Zac’s Reviews > Scarlet Witch, Vol. 3: The Final Hex > Status Update

Zac
Zac is 20% done
May 08, 2025 07:15PM
Scarlet Witch, Vol. 3: The Final Hex

flag

No comments have been added yet.